Charles Hand Completes 10 Years of Service to Clarksville-Montgomery County Airport Authority
Hand has been a member of the airport’s governing board since July 1st, 2007, serving two consecutive five-year terms, the maximum continuous allowed by the authority’s bylaws. His second term expires as of June 30th, 2017. ![]() Charles Hand, left, was recognized for 10 years of service to the Clarksville-Montgomery County Airport Authority. Austin Peay State University’s Governor Peay has a challenger for APSU mascotAPSU Sports Information
Unchallenged for years as the official mascot for Austin Peay State University, Governor Peay X’s stranglehold on that role appears in serious jeopardy. A new candidate – known as ‘The Gov’ – has emerged to oppose the incumbent in a race to become the face of Austin Peay. Austin Peay is rife with change at the moment. A new logo, refurbished football stadium and the addition of new President Dr. Alisa White have made the climate right for a challenger to a long-established figure. Though a newcomer to the mascot world, The Gov has picked an opportune moment to throw his hat into the ring to become Austin Peay’s next mascot. «Read the rest of this article» Sections: Sports | No Comments

Budweiser of Clarksville becomes Clarksville-Montgomery County Green Certified
Charles Hand, Chairman of the Board of Hand Family Companies, has a history of taking care of the environment. For decades, Hand has been doing his part to keep our community clean. His actions carried over to his family businesses when the Company began participating in the Adopt-A-Highway Program in the early 1990s, and the efforts have been growing ever since. «Read the rest of this article» Sections: Business | No Comments
